Can I really win money playing live roulette from my phone in 2026?

Yeah, you can. But the house edge is still there. For European roulette (single zero), it’s about 2.7%. For American (double zero), it’s 5.26%. Always pick European tables. I’ve had sessions where I’ve turned £20 into £200. I’ve also lost £100 in 20 minutes. It’s gambling, not a job.

How fast are the withdrawals from UKGC casinos?

Depends on the method. Debit cards (Visa/Mastercard) usually take 1-3 working days. E-wallets like PayPal or Skrill? Usually within 24 hours, sometimes instantly. I use PayPal for everything now. Faster, less hassle. Bet365 pays out to PayPal within an hour most of the time.
